### Step 4: Planner regression check

After upgrading Quillbase to 9.2, the query planner may prefer sequential scans on the archive partitions, regressing report latency badly. Verify the planner overrides before opening traffic, and hold the release if estimates look wrong. The overrides we ship for this release are as follows.

deployment values, yadug-bawif:
[framir]
team = pelox
access_code = ac_a38ab2
owner = tamion.julael
host = framir.tolvaqlabs.test
port = 11211
peer = tammir.zemvargrid.local
salt = 2215ef03
pin = 1541

Subject: CSV wizard DR drill — for your review

Hey! Quick note ahead of Friday's disaster-recovery drill on the Gristmill CSV import wizard. We'll simulate a corrupted staging bucket and restore from snapshot; feel free to poke holes in the process as we go. To access the sealed restore bundle, you'll need the recovery passphrase below.

unlock words, kawig-bawef: belax-sorir-druax-ulaiel-wenael-belael

**CI note: timezone weirdness in report exports**

Heads up, support folks — if a customer says their Ledgerpine export shows times shifted by a few hours, it's probably the CI image. The export workers got rebuilt last week and the base image defaults to UTC, while older workers used the account's locale. Fix is rolling out; meanwhile tell customers the data itself is fine, just the display offset. Affected exports carry the build token shown below.

build token for bajof-tahop: htk4_a981